Phonetics Define Phonetics at Dictionary com language Definition Characteristics amp Change June 24th, 2024 - Phonetics covers much of the ground loosely referred to in language study as pronunciation Webbsemantics [Gr.,=significant] in general, the study of the relationship between words and meanings. The empirical study of word meanings and sentence meanings in existing languages is a branch of linguistics; the abstract study of meaning in relation to language or symbolic logic systems is a branch of philosophy. Both are called semantics.
